That’s quite a lot – about a billion times the total number of baryons in the observable universe. … Web23 mrt. 2005 · The flux of neutrinos from the sun at the surface of the earth is 6×10 10 neutrinos per square centimeter and second. The neutrinos from the fusion process in the sun can pass through several light years of solid lead before being absorbed by matter.
